dc.description.abstract Augmented Reality is a ground breaking technology that can effectively simplify complex operations. Augmented Reality blends virtual and original realities, providing new tools to the user to ensure the efficiency of knowledge transfer across different processes and different environments. Various solutions based on Augmented Reality have been suggested by the research community: Augmented Reality tools have provided new perspectives and promised dramatic improvements, especially in the maintenance program. Augmented Reality, on the other hand, is a final claiming technology and, at present, it is still affected by serious flaws that undermine its implementation in the context of the industry . This paper presents examples of Augmented Reality applications and demonstrates the potential of Augmented Reality solutions in maintenance tasks, outlining the benefits it can introduce. At the same time the main drawbacks of Augmented Reality are commented on and possible lines of inquiry are suggested. en_US
